8.2.3 Twelve Monthly

a) Service pump, tubing and capstans – see Section 8.2.6.
b) Replace all internal plumbing tubing – see Section 8.2.7.
c) Carry out the normal 4 weekly schedule not already covered
above.

8.2.4 Consumables Spares Kit

The monitor is supplied with a consumable spares kit (see
Section 10). This consumable spares kit includes all the
components which are recommended for replacement annually
(refer to the details in the spares kit). This annual refurbishment
ensures a high level of reliability from the monitor over a period of
many years. The kit should be reordered when used so that all the
items are available throughout the following year's operation. The
consumable spares kit is in addition to the electrode spares kits
for the chloride electrode.
The kit contains the following:
one set of pump tubing
one set of pump capstans
a complete set of plumbing tubing
sundry items – 'O' rings, tube connectors, pump tube
bungs and fuses
plastic syringe and bottle brush – for cleaning pipework,
valves, flowcell and constant-head unit.

8.2.5 Fitting the Electrodes

The chloride electrode is supplied with a protective end cap to
prevent the tip from being scratched or chipped. To prepare for
use, remove the end cap and carefully rinse the tip in distilled
water.
a) Fit the chloride electrode into the plastic holder supplied, slide
the retaining 'O' ring over the end of the electrode body and
insert it into the sloping aperture of the flowcell. Screw down to
compress the 'O' ring. Push the electrode down as far into the
flow cell as practical without fouling the stirrer drum.
b) Connect the chloride electrode lead to the co-axial socket
above the flowcell on the right hand side.
c) The reference electrode should have the rubber stopper
removed from the refill aperture. Remove teat and top-up
electrode with filling solution if required.
d) Fit the 'O' ring supplied over the reference electrode body and
insert the electrode into the left hand chamber of the flowcell
so that the ceramic plug is between 5 and 10 mm from the
bottom.
e) Connect the reference electrode lead to the co-axial socket
above the flowcell on the left hand side.
